Responsibilities:
  • Provide positive quality interactions to residents specific to their individual interests with a focus on interpersonal relationships and quality of life
  • Assist nurse with managing, treating, and responding to resident care needs
  • Assist residents with daily hygiene activities (bathing, dressing, grooming, etc.)
  • Assisting residents with mobility including lifting, positioning, and transporting
  • Answering resident calls in a timely manner
  • Assisting residents with daily meals and feeding
  • Observe residents and note their physical condition, attitude, reactions, appetite, etc. Spend as much time listening as talking.  Share resident/family concerns and any changes in the resident’s condition with your supervisor.
  • Come to work as scheduled and consistently demonstrate dependability and punctuality.
